Discover the vibrant essence of London through the pages of Londoners by Craig Taylor. Published in 2012, this compelling book offers an extraordinary group portrait of contemporary London, capturing the rich, dynamic, and diverse tapestry of life in this iconic city. With 448 pages filled with engaging narratives, Londoners presents a unique oral history that delves into the social life and customs of its inhabitants. From bustling streets to hidden corners, this book invites readers to experience the multifaceted civilization of Great Britain’s capital.
